LILAC MAY 2023 PD WORKSHOP & LUNCHEON

Friday, May 19, 2023

12:00 p.m. - 3:00 p.m.

During this professional development and networking event, we will be honoring the local New York State English Council Educators of Excellence and our Kenneth Gambone Writing Contest winners.

Our featured presenter is local author, Gina Mingoia, who will share her experiences, inspirations, and the power of writing as a path toward healing through her discussion, “On Perseverance, Writing, and Healing.”

LILAC Mini-Grant Program

Applications will be accepted from October 24, 2022 through December 9, 2022.

LILAC offers two annual mini-grant awards for $500 each, one elementary and one secondary. The members of our Mini-Grant Committee review all applications and choose the best ideas to support the learning needs of a targeted group of students or of a larger population.
